Maine Yankee Atomic Power Co Emp Welfare Benefit Pl & Tr Veba
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 1,280,548 | 895,983 | 384,565 | 228.3 | 1% |
| 2020 | 1,328,228 | 982,908 | 345,320 | 227.0 | 1% |
| 2021 | 2,015,817 | 905,252 | 1,110,565 | 270.1 | 1% |
| 2022 | 2,101,562 | 946,243 | 1,155,319 | 218.5 | 1% |
| 2023 | 1,273,860 | 883,919 | 389,941 | 251.1 | 1%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$389,941 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 251.1 months of spending, up from 228.3 in 2019. Staff pay was 1%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
